mirror of
https://github.com/wwiinnddyy/LanMountainDesktop.git
synced 2026-06-20 23:54:26 +08:00
6.9 KiB
6.9 KiB
快速安装
本指南将帮助你快速安装和运行阑山桌面。
安装方式
方式一:使用安装包(推荐)
下载安装包
访问 GitHub Releases 页面,下载最新版本的安装包:
- Windows x64:
LanMountainDesktop-Setup-{version}-x64.exe
运行安装程序
- 双击下载的安装包
- 按照安装向导提示完成安装
- 安装完成后,启动器会自动运行
首次启动 (OOBE)
首次启动时会显示欢迎页面:
- 欢迎页 - 项目介绍和基本说明
- 权限确认 - 了解应用所需的权限
- 基础设置 - 选择主题、语言等
- 完成 - 开始使用阑山桌面
方式二:便携版
下载便携包
从 GitHub Releases 下载:
- Windows x64:
LanMountainDesktop-Portable-{version}-x64.zip
解压并运行
# 解压到目标目录
Expand-Archive -Path LanMountainDesktop-Portable-1.0.0-x64.zip -DestinationPath C:\LanMountainDesktop
# 进入目录
cd C:\LanMountainDesktop
# 启动应用
.\LanMountainDesktop.Launcher.exe
便携版特点
- ✅ 无需安装,解压即用
- ✅ 数据存储在程序目录
- ✅ 适合 U 盘或多机器同步使用
- ⚠️ 需要手动创建快捷方式
- ⚠️ 不会自动添加到开始菜单
目录结构
安装版目录结构
安装根目录/
├── LanMountainDesktop.Launcher.exe # 启动器(唯一入口)
├── app-1.0.0/ # 版本目录
│ ├── .current # 当前版本标记
│ ├── LanMountainDesktop.exe # 主程序
│ ├── *.dll # 依赖库
│ └── ...
├── LanMountainDesktop.AirAppRuntime.exe # Air APP 运行时
├── .Launcher/ # 启动器数据
│ ├── state/ # OOBE 状态
│ └── update/ # 更新缓存
└── unins000.exe # 卸载程序
用户数据目录
%LOCALAPPDATA%\LanMountainDesktop\
├── settings/ # 设置文件
├── plugins/ # 已安装插件
├── logs/ # 日志文件
├── cache/ # 缓存数据
└── telemetry/ # 遥测数据(可选)
便携版目录结构
便携版的用户数据存储在程序目录的 Data/ 文件夹下:
LanMountainDesktop/
├── LanMountainDesktop.Launcher.exe
├── app-1.0.0/
├── Data/ # 便携数据目录
│ ├── settings/
│ ├── plugins/
│ ├── logs/
│ └── cache/
└── ...
启动选项
正常启动
# 双击启动器
.\LanMountainDesktop.Launcher.exe
# 或从开始菜单启动
命令行选项
# 显示版本信息
.\LanMountainDesktop.Launcher.exe --version
# 显示帮助信息
.\LanMountainDesktop.Launcher.exe --help
# 重置 OOBE 状态(重新显示欢迎页)
.\LanMountainDesktop.Launcher.exe --reset-oobe
# 启动到指定版本
.\LanMountainDesktop.Launcher.exe --version 1.0.0
# 安装插件(本地维护命令)
.\LanMountainDesktop.Launcher.exe plugin install path\to\plugin.laapp
# 应用插件更新队列(本地维护命令)
.\LanMountainDesktop.Launcher.exe plugin update
验证安装
检查应用状态
启动后,你应该看到:
- 桌面组件 - 默认的时钟或其他组件显示在桌面上
- 系统托盘图标 - 阑山桌面的托盘图标
- 主窗口 - 可通过托盘图标打开
检查日志
如果遇到问题,可以查看日志:
# 打开日志目录
explorer %LOCALAPPDATA%\LanMountainDesktop\logs
# 查看最新日志
Get-Content %LOCALAPPDATA%\LanMountainDesktop\logs\latest.log -Tail 50
检查版本信息
- 右键点击托盘图标
- 选择"关于"或"设置"
- 查看版本号和构建信息
常见问题
安装失败
问题: 安装程序报错或无法完成安装
解决方案:
- 确认 Windows 版本 ≥ Windows 10 1809
- 以管理员身份运行安装程序
- 关闭杀毒软件和防火墙
- 检查磁盘空间是否充足(≥ 500MB)
- 查看安装日志:
%TEMP%\LanMountainDesktop-Setup.log
启动失败
问题: 双击启动器没有反应
解决方案:
- 检查进程管理器是否已有实例运行
- 查看日志文件:
%LOCALAPPDATA%\LanMountainDesktop\logs\latest.log - 尝试以管理员身份运行
- 检查是否有其他应用占用端口或资源
OOBE 无法显示
问题: 首次启动没有显示欢迎页面
解决方案:
- 删除 OOBE 状态文件:
Remove-Item -Path "$env:LOCALAPPDATA\LanMountainDesktop\.launcher\state\oobe-state.json" -Force - 重新启动应用
组件不显示
问题: 桌面上看不到任何组件
解决方案:
- 右键点击桌面空白处
- 选择"添加组件"
- 选择一个组件添加到桌面
- 检查组件是否被其他窗口遮挡
- 确认桌面图层设置正确(设置 → 桌面 → 图层模式)
卸载应用
使用控制面板
- 打开"设置" → "应用" → "已安装的应用"
- 找到"LanMountainDesktop"
- 点击"卸载"按钮
- 按照向导完成卸载
使用卸载程序
# 运行卸载程序
.\unins000.exe
清理残留数据
卸载后,用户数据不会自动删除。如需彻底清理:
# 删除用户数据目录
Remove-Item -Path "$env:LOCALAPPDATA\LanMountainDesktop" -Recurse -Force
# 删除 Launcher 状态
Remove-Item -Path "$env:LOCALAPPDATA\LanMountainDesktop\.launcher" -Recurse -Force
# 删除缓存(如果存在)
Remove-Item -Path "$env:TEMP\LanMountainDesktop" -Recurse -Force -ErrorAction SilentlyContinue
更新应用
自动更新(推荐)
阑山桌面支持自动更新:
- 应用会在后台检查更新
- 发现新版本时会提示下载
- 下载完成后重启应用自动安装
- 支持增量更新,只下载变更文件
手动更新
如果需要手动更新:
- 访问 GitHub Releases
- 下载最新版本的安装包
- 运行安装包,选择"覆盖安装"
- 安装完成后启动新版本
更新频道
可以在设置中切换更新频道:
- Stable(稳定版): 只接收正式发布的版本
- Preview(预览版): 接收所有版本,包括预发布版本
设置 → 更新 → 更新频道 → 选择频道